Output 65ea1897a8fdf5ede020d86b1ae58b9b76f0d6008ca9ff522ac5daa121e59a94:8

value
58700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11d69104f913f69a312fe202e8ee6a18ebe445b OP_EQUAL
address
3HqWky8Kp6VGqKB8F4ocHyt63ZyBCYDqT9
transaction
65ea1897a8fdf5ede020d86b1ae58b9b76f0d6008ca9ff522ac5daa121e59a94
spent
true